Statute of Limitations

In order to receive compensation for asbestos-related illnesses victims typically make a personal injury claim against the parties who were negligent. This includes companies that mined asbestos, or produced asbestos-containing materials, as as their direct employers. The money awarded will help victims and their families pay for the costs related to mesothelioma treatment including medical bills and lost wages.


Asbestos lawyers can assist victims family members and loved ones determine if they're qualified for certain types of claims. These claims could include worker compensation, which offers financial aid for mesothelioma related expenses. It is crucial for patients to contact a mesothelioma lawyer as soon as they are diagnosed. This will ensure that victims' lawsuits are filed within the applicable statute of limitations.

The statute of limitations differs by state however, they generally range between two and four years. The timelines start at the time a patient receives an official diagnosis (personal injuries claims) or dies (wrongful death claims). The statute of limitations is affected by a myriad of factors which include the nature and location of the exposure, the workplace where the victim was exposed, and the location where the victim was employed.

The time it takes for doctors to determine mesothelioma's diagnosis is another factor that affects the statute of limitation. Litigation Process

The legal process for obtaining mesothelioma-related compensation is a complex. The mesothelioma lawyers at Frost Law Firm can help patients and their families to file a lawsuit against asbestos-related companies accountable for asbestos exposure and the resulting illness.

A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can determine if an agreement or trial is better for the client's situation. In most cases the defendant won't decide to bring their case to trial because it could lead to them having to pay punitive damages. Punitive damages allow the plaintiff to punish defendants for their lack of diligence.

Mesothelioma attorneys will gather evidence during the lawsuit process and use it to build a convincing case. Interviewing witnesses, collecting evidence of asbestos exposure in the workplace (such as pay stubs, pay slips and invoices) and analyzing diagnostic test result are all part of this process. Mesothelioma attorneys also have access to huge databases that provide information on thousands of job sites and asbestos products and can conduct new investigations into workplaces to gather more evidence of asbestos exposure.

Once the mesothelioma attorneys have gathered enough evidence they will negotiate with lawyers representing the defendant to reach an out-of-court settlement. In the majority of instances, it takes eighteen months for a mesothelioma settlement to be reached. In the majority of cases, the amount of the settlement is kept confidential because both parties sign confidentiality agreements. Certain jury awards for mesothelioma compensation are made public.

Settlements

Mesothelioma victims and their families could be entitled to compensation for financial losses. Compensation may help pay for expenses like medical bills, home care, living expenses and more. Individuals may receive compensation through mesothelioma lawsuits or trust fund, as well as government programs.

A mesothelioma suit aims to hold defendants accountable for asbestos exposure. A lawsuit can result in a settlement or a trial verdict. Settlements are made through negotiations between attorneys for the plaintiff and defendant. Trial verdicts involve the verdict of jurors or judges on the amount that defendants must be required to pay in order to compensate for their negligence. Settlements typically provide faster settlements for families and have higher payout amounts than a trial verdict.

Compensation for mesothelioma can be available through long-term disability, Social Security disability payments and programs specifically designed for veterans with the disease.
